England beat Germany 2-0 to reach Euro 2020 quarterfinals

RAHEEM STERLING and Harry Kane fired England into the Euro 2020 quarterfinals as they sealed a 2-0 win against Germany that ended decades of hurt at the hands of their bitter rivals on Tuesday (29).

Sterling struck with 15 minutes left in a tense last 16 tie at Wembley before Kane clinched England's first knockout stage victory over Germany since 1966.


In the 55 years since England beat the Germans in the World Cup final, the Three Lions had endured a painful litany of defeats against Die Mannschaft when the stakes were highest.

England were eliminated from the 1970, 1990 and 2010 World Cups by Germany, who also beat them in the Euro 96 semifinals at Wembley.

But Gareth Southgate's side have finally exorcised the ghosts of Paul Gascoigne's tears and their own manager's penalty miss 25 years ago.

England produced a gritty display capped by clinical finishes from Sterling, who now has three goals in the tournament, and Kane - who finally bagged his first of the competition.

England, yet to concede a goal in the tournament, head to Rome on Saturday for a quarterfinal against the winners of Tuesday's other last 16 tie between Sweden and Ukraine.

Chasing a first major international trophy since 1966, England's side of the draw looks wide open, with a potential semi-final against Denmark or the Czech Republic unlikely to strike fear into their hearts.

It was only England's second knockout stage win in the history of the European Championship and their first victory over Germany at Wembley since 1975.

For Germany manager Joachim Loew, it was an agonising end to his reign as he prepares to step down after the tournament.

Always keen to deflect attention, Southgate will have relished his moment of redemption, especially since his decision to switch to a three-man defence to match up with the German formation paid off.

With the vast majority of the 40,000 crowd supporting England, the players walked out to a wall of sound that included a hostile reception for the German national anthem.

Knockout blow

England needed a tone-setting moment to ease their visible anxiety early on and Sterling provided it as he drove forward for a 25-yard blast that forced a fine save from Manuel Neuer.

With Harry Maguire winning a series of thunderous headers and tackles and Bukayo Saka probing intelligently on the right flank, England gradually took control.

However, Germany almost snatched the lead as Kai Havertz played an inch-perfect pass to Timo Werner inside the England area.

But Werner endured a dismal first season in front of goal for Chelsea and once again he was unable to produce a precise finish as he shot straight at Jordan Pickford.

A misplaced pass from Thomas Mueller sent Sterling scampering through the Germany defence on the stroke of half-time.

Yet when the ball ran to Kane, he was too slow to apply the finishing touch as he rounded Neuer and Mats Hummels' tackle snuffed out the danger.

Havertz's blistering half-volley forced a superb tip over from Pickford soon after the interval.

It was Saka who made way when Southgate made his first change, sending on Jack Grealish in a game-defining moment.

Grealish's presence immediately brought more energy to England and in the 75th minute they finally delivered the knockout blow.

Grealish worked the ball wide to Luke Shaw and his low cross reached Sterling, who pounced with a clinical close-range finish to send Wembley into ecstasy.

Mueller should have equalised when Havertz's pass sent him clean through, but the Bayern Munich star rolled his shot wide and fell to the turf in dismay.

Kane made Mueller pay in the 86th minute as he finished off a lethal England counter-attack with a diving header past Neuer from Grealish's cross.

During the first day of England's Euro camp at St George's Park, Southgate showed his squad a motivational video featuring some of the team's greatest victories.

Now they have added their own chapter to the list of England's finest moments.

Saif Ali Khan’s first interview since home invasion: What he revealed amid controversy & conspiracy theories

In a shocking turn of events, Bollywood star Saif Ali Khan found himself in a real-life thriller when an armed intruder broke into his Mumbai residence in the dead of night. What was supposed to be just another peaceful evening in the Khan household turned into a night of horror, leaving Saif with multiple injuries and raising serious questions about celebrity security in India.

It all began when Saif, in his kurta-pyjama, heard unusual noises near his son Jeh’s room. What followed was a violent struggle with an intruder armed with two knives. “I didn’t realise it was a knife at first,” Saif recalled. “There was too much adrenaline. He was slashing at my neck, and I was blocking it with my hands. My palms, wrists, and arms were cut, but I didn’t feel the pain immediately.”

Speaking to Times of India, the actor shared how his quick reflexes and the sharp presence of mind of his househelp, Geeta, saved the day. “I was praying someone would get him off me,” Saif admitted. “Geeta was incredible. She shoved him away, and we managed to close the door.”

Meanwhile, Kareena Kapoor Khan sprang into action, ensuring their children, Taimur and Jeh, were safe. “Kareena was shouting, ‘Take the kid out!’” Saif shared. “She got Jeh out of harm’s way while I was still grappling with the intruder.”

What makes this story even more astonishing is the extent of Saif’s injuries. A knife had penetrated his back, nicking his spinal cord and causing spinal fluid to leak. “The doctors said it was a millimetre away from paralysis,” Saif revealed. “It’s a miracle I can walk.”

Despite the severity of his wounds, Saif remained remarkably composed. “I told Kareena, ‘I’m fine. I’m not going to die.’ Taimur asked me the same thing, and I reassured him too,” he said. The family’s decision to take an autorickshaw to the hospital made the situation feel all the more unreal. “The rickshaw driver saw the blood but stayed calm. He even took shortcuts to avoid bumps,” Saif recalled with a laugh.

While the physical scars are healing, the emotional impact lingers. Saif’s children have reacted in their own ways. “Jeh gave me a plastic sword and said, ‘Keep this by your bed for the next time the chor comes,’” Saif shared with a chuckle. Taimur, ever the composed one, has shown concern about security but remains unfazed.

As for the intruder, Saif harbours no hatred. “Taimur said he should be forgiven because he might have been hungry,” Saif said. “I understand desperation, but he crossed a line when he tried to kill me.”

Saif’s ordeal has sparked debates about celebrity security and urban safety. Yet, the actor remains unfazed. “I don’t believe in walking around with bodyguards. This wasn’t a targeted attack; it was a burglary gone wrong,” he insisted.

“It’s brought us closer as a family,” he admitted. “Kareena has been incredibly strong, and the kids have shown maturity beyond their years.”

Squid Game season 3 episode leak shocks fans as finale length disappoints viewers

A recent leak has stirred up mixed reactions among Squid Game fans, revealing a possible episode count for the highly anticipated third season. While excitement for the final chapter of the hit series is palpable, disappointment is brewing over reports that the concluding season may only have six episodes.

According to a recent post on the fan forum Instiz, Squid Game Seasons 2 and 3 were filmed back-to-back, with a combined total of 13 episodes. Since Season 2, released in December 2024, consisted of seven episodes, this leaves Season 3 with just six episodes to wrap up the intricate storyline. Fans are worried that such a limited number of episodes might not do justice to the narrative, especially considering the complexity of the plot and characters. Some fans are hopeful that Netflix or director Hwang Dong Hyuk might announce additional episodes, but so far, no official confirmation has been given.

On the brighter side, reports about the show’s massive production budget have sparked excitement. Media outlets revealed that Seasons 2 and 3 were produced with a combined budget of ₩100 billion KRW (approximately £54.3 million GBP). This massive budget hints at high-quality production, elaborate sets, and intense action sequences.

Despite the budget news, some fans expressed shock at the cost, with one commenting, “That’s too expensive for just six episodes.” Others, however, remain confident that the show’s global popularity will ensure profitability. “Season 1 was a worldwide hit, so even if Seasons 2 and 3 don’t perform as well, it will still be profitable,” a fan noted.

With just a few months between the release of Season 2 in December 2024 and the arrival of Season 3 in June 2025, the wait feels long for eager fans. Amid the debates over episode count and budget, fans are also speculating about the storyline. Will Seong Gi Hun survive? Could a new winner emerge? Stills from the series have also fuelled theories, showcasing high-tension moments, the return of the enigmatic Front Man, and a potential escape plan by a pink soldier.

Indian police probe influencer Ranveer Allahbadia for sexual joke about reality show contestant's parents

Popular podcaster Ranveer Allahbadia, widely known as BeerBiceps, has landed in hot water over a controversial remark he made on India’s Got Latent, a show hosted by comedian Samay Raina. Following backlash online, the Mumbai Police have initiated an enquiry into the matter.

What happened?

During a recent episode of India’s Got Latent, where Ranveer appeared as a guest alongside content creators Ashish Chanchlani, Jaspreet Singh, and Apoorva Mukhija, he asked a contestant an inappropriate question that quickly sparked outrage. While the panel and audience laughed at the moment, the reaction online was anything but forgiving.

On Monday morning, lawyers Ashish Rai and Pankaj Mishra filed a formal complaint with the Mumbai Police, alleging that the remarks were obscene and offensive. Authorities soon visited the Khar-based Habitat building, where the show was recorded, to investigate the incident. Deputy Commissioner of Police Dikshit Gedam confirmed that an enquiry is underway, though no FIR has been registered yet.
